Etymology

Phono-semantic compound (形聲 /形声, OC *sŋeːs): semantic 女 + phonetic 胥 (OC *sŋa, *sŋaʔ). Attested in Qin materials as ⿰士咠, which is of semantic 士 + phonetic 咠 (OC *ʔsib, *sʰib); the phonetic part is later conflated into 胥 (Li, 2022). Reminiscent of Proto-South-Bahnaric *saːj (“to marry; spouse”) (Schuessler, 2007). The Standard Mandarin pronunciation xù is due to rounding assimilation in the word 女婿 (nǚxu), which generalized to the character reading (Zhou, 1997).
